You may have what they call "thrush."  This fungal infections (yeast)  happens in some people and results from all the antibiotics that end up killing off even the friendly bacteria that you need in your stomach.  Look at your tongue.  Does it have a white coating that sort of scrapes off with some effort?  Thrush comes UP from the digestive tract so if it's in your mouth it is blooming down there.  You'll need to go to the doctor and get a prescription for....probably Nystatin which they'll give you either in a the form of lozenges or a liquid that you swish and swallow a little bit at a time, four times a day.
